What Are Internet Capital Markets (ICM)?
Jul 17, 2025

Internet Capital Markets (ICM) refer to a new generation of financial markets powered by blockchain and decentralized technologies. Unlike traditional capital markets, which rely on centralized intermediaries like stock exchanges and investment banks, ICMs operate natively on the internet—open, programmable, and globally accessible. For crypto beginners, ICM represents a gateway to understanding how decentralized finance (DeFi), tokenization, and blockchain are transforming access to capital and investment opportunities. What Are Internet Capital Markets?
Internet Capital Markets (ICM) are blockchain-based systems where financial instruments—such as tokens, digital assets, or securities—are created, issued, traded, and settled entirely online without relying on traditional financial infrastructure.
These markets are enabled by smart contracts and decentralized platforms. They bring capital formation and investment activity onto permissionless, global networks.
Key elements of ICM include:
On-chain issuance of assets such as tokens, stablecoins, and synthetic securities
24/7 borderless trading across DeFi platforms
Automated settlement using smart contracts
Direct access to capital without banks or brokers
Integration with decentralized applications (dApps) and protocols
Benefits of Internet Capital Markets
ICMs offer a number of advantages over traditional capital markets. They remove intermediaries, increase transparency, and unlock access to financial tools for individuals worldwide—especially those underserved by legacy systems.
These features are particularly attractive to crypto beginners and global entrepreneurs.
Key benefits include:
Global participation, no geographic restrictions
Lower barriers to entry, even with small capital
Faster settlement and reduced fees via automation
Programmable financial logic, enabling innovation
Greater transparency, with all transactions recorded on-chain
Use Cases of ICM
Internet Capital Markets are already being used in real-world scenarios, especially in the decentralized finance (DeFi) space. From tokenized funds to peer-to-peer lending, ICMs are changing how capital flows online.
Examples of ICM in action:
Tokenized equity or startup shares traded on blockchain
On-chain fundraising via token launches or initial DEX offerings (IDOs)
Decentralized lending and borrowing platforms
Yield-bearing tokenized assets, such as real estate or treasury bills
Permissionless liquidity markets, allowing anyone to provide capital
